Give two of your own examples of square roots that are irrational numbers and two rational numbers .

Mathematics
2 answers:
Basile [38]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

irrational number √3 can't be written as a ratio of two integers numbers.​​

irrational number √5 ​can't be written as a ratio of two integers numbers.

rational number √4 can be written as a ratio of two integer numbers 2/1

rational number √9 can be written as a ratio of two integer numbers​ 3/1

In what ways are products of fractions similar to products of integers?
zhannawk [14.2K]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

Products of fractions can be similar to products of integers because the product of the fraction can cancel out or simplify to an integer. For example:

1/2 x 2/1

Any number multiplied by its reciprocal is equal to 1.

The same rules for multiplying positive and negative integers still applies to multiplying positive and negative fractions.
